Suneagles Golf Club
Played On 03/08/2021Improvements are great
I'm amazed by how much money the owners are putting into this course, and it shows. They are really trying to make Suneagles a top course in the area. New drainage, new bunkers, new greens on 16 and 17, fairway repairs, and even cleaned up the ponds. Its nice to see money going back in to a course instead of the owners bank account, which sadly is what a lot of public courses do. Steve is great, very processional, very friendly place. 4 stars because repairs are still coming along and theres two temp greens.
Spooky Brook Golf Course
Played On 01/04/2020Great greens
Greens always seem to be in great condition, even in winter. Course is wide but its not totally flat like some reviews suggest. There's plenty of rolling hills to keep things interesting and still easy to walk. Low rough + generous fairways means quick pace of play. Since its wide open, wind can be a real issue. Whatever the forecast says for wind, double it at least.

Heron Glen Golf Course
Played On 08/15/2013Can't believe its a Muni
Very interesting, picturesque links style layout. Greens are a bit speedy and there's plenty of sand. If the fescue is up bring some extra balls. The course demands a bit of thought, which i really like. And it always seems to be in pristine condition, even when other nearby courses are taking a hit, Heron Glen remains unscathed. Definitely one of the best maintained public courses in NJ. The only negative is that it is a VERY busy course. Good for the club; not for the golfer. Rangers do their best with the hand they've been dealt, but the real problem seems to be over-booking, which leads to unmanageable crowded conditions. The Club House? Yeah, its basically a double wide trailer. But I don't go to golf courses to eat or roam around the clubhouse. Heron glen is a must play for any serious golfer.
